COMPANY 8Ui <br /> 2737 41. COMMODORE WAY 1.654 W. v---LTE <br /> SEATTLE, WA 98199 MANTE:CA, Lii +506 <br /> In late 1983, the Governor signed into law AB2013 and 1362. These Bills require <br /> the inventory, inspection and permitting of all underground storage tanks that <br /> contain hazardous materials. The San Joaquin Local. Health District, Division <br /> of Environmental Health was designated as the enforcement agency for the <br /> cities and unincorporated areas within San Joaquin County. State law provides <br /> for a fee system to cover the cost of implementing this state mandated <br /> program. <br /> Local 'fees (see attached Fee Schedule) , for these required inspectional <br /> services, will be billed on a yearly basis. The facilities Permit to Operate <br /> will be issued for a five year period. In addition to the yearly <br /> inspectional fee, this statement will also include a $56/tank State surcharge <br /> fee. The State surcharge fee per tank will be charged every five years or <br /> whenever the facilities permit is renewed or amended. All State surcharge <br /> fees will be transmitted by the Health District to the California Water <br /> Resources Control. Board. <br /> To apply for a facilities Permit to Operate, complete the attached Fee <br /> Worksheet and submit the appropriate fees. Fees are due and payable February <br /> 3, 1986. Fees received after March 6, 1986 are subject to 100% penalty. <br /> In order to answe=r any questions regarding this Underground Storage Tank <br /> program, the San Joaquin Local.
